这事儿我琢磨了好一阵子,就是想在自己的小网站上加个投票功能,弄得花里胡哨的,大家看着也高兴。毕竟一个死气沉沉的页面,没人互动,挺没劲的。
一开始我还琢磨着自己写个后端服务,搞个数据库存票数,前端用点JavaScript偷偷摸摸提交数据。后来一想,太费劲了,我这小网站,图个方便就行,实在没必要搞这么大动静。于是我就搁置了那个想法,转而琢磨那些成熟的第三方服务。
我试了好几个平台,有的界面丑,有的还得收费,我定下了某个看起来比较顺眼的在线投票工具。这东西的好处就是省心,你只管在它那里把投票内容搭它给你一套代码,你直接往自己网站上一贴就行了。
选工具,搭架子
我打开那个工具的网站,注册了个账号。注册过程挺简单,输个邮箱密码就完事了。进去以后,我点开了“新建投票”的按钮。

得给投票起个名,我就随便写了个“你最喜欢哪个配色方案?”。
接着就是设置选项。我准备了几个常见的颜色,比如“深色模式”、“亮色模式”、“怀旧绿”什么的,一个一个往里填。我看了看设置,发现还能设置截止时间,但我这回先不设,让它一直开着。
搞定了选项,我得看看这投票是怎么展示的。它提供几种视图,我一眼就看中了那个带点动画效果的条形图展示方式,看起来比较“酷”。设置完这些,我点击了“生成代码”。
嵌入网站,搞定显示
点完生成代码,页面上蹦出来一大段代码,基本上就是一段HTML和JavaScript的组合体,我一看就知道这是个嵌入代码。

我赶紧把这段代码复制下来。然后,我就打开了我自己网站的后台,找到我那个想放投票的页面文件,具体来说,是我用静态HTML生成的那个页面。
我找到页面中大概位置,就是我想要投票条出现的地方。我深吸一口气,把刚才复制的代码,原封不动地贴了进去。我没敢乱动它里面的任何一个字符,生怕一动它就罢工了。
贴完之后,我保存了文件,然后手动刷新了一下浏览器,看看效果。
刚开始加载有点慢,我等了一小会儿,果然,一个规规矩矩,还挺漂亮的投票框就出现在我网页的那个位置上了!选项清晰,投票按钮也挺明显。
测试互动,确认效果
我赶紧点了一下“亮色模式”,然后点“提交”。网页没刷新,底下那个条形图唰地一下就跳了一下,显示我投的那个选项的得票率。看起来很流畅,没有卡顿的感觉。
我把页面关了,隔了五分钟又打开,发现我刚才投的那一票还记着,票数没变。这说明它数据是实时同步到那个第三方平台上了。
整个过程下来,我发现这比自己从零开始搭建系统要简单太多了。我不用操心服务器压力,不用担心数据安全,只要对方平台不跑路就行。这招对搞个人博客或者小型展示站来说,简直是救星。









